Temporomandibular joint

The temporomandibular joint is a joint connecting the lower jaw, called the mandible, to the temporal bone at the side of the head. It allows a diverse range of movement to occur, the jaw can open and shut, but also move in and out and side to side.

It is a synovial joint with a loose capsule, and acts as a modified hinge joint.
